81

...women have signed up to date for the Arizona Casting for Recovery retreat this year. 81!!!!! that is so wonderful in so many ways but also so sad. We can only have 14 survivors at our retreats so that leaves 67 ladies that won't be able to attend...that's very sad.

Even if they found a cure today, this very minute, think how many survivors are out there that need the support and recovery guidance...we will always be out there!!

Next year we will have two retreats...May and September...and that will allow 28 women to have this wonderful experience...which is great! We will continue to work toward more and more retreats so that more and more women will have this opportunity.

TWO in 2011

APPROVED!!!!!
Arizona Casting for Recovery will have TWO retreats in 2011. One in May and one in September. Instead of only 14 women, we will be able to take 28 women to Greer for a retreat!!!

This is a big step. More staff trained, more supplies, more paperwork, more, more, more BUT more importantly...more participants!!!!!!
